Transaction 61788e77c778cc4c09afec40d6e3904d99dd133ccf44e93a93036431b9edcc24
1 Input
1 Output
-
61788e77c778cc4c09afec40d6e3904d99dd133ccf44e93a93036431b9edcc24:0
- value
- 10934700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48948029d56cc496574685ef8638eb293f13d128 OP_EQUAL
- address
- 38JnUMsva1o5NmkRAvwU4eodNrHLtcLj3m